Beginnings of Russian Math



The beginnings of Russian mathematics can be traced back to the early 18th century, during the power of Peter the Great, that dramatically reformed and updated numerous facets of Russian society, including education and learning. Identifying the importance of scientific and technological expertise for national development, Peter the Great established the Institution of Mathematical and Navigational Sciences in 1701. This institution noted the beginning of organized mathematical education in Russia and laid the groundwork for future advancements.


Throughout the 19th century, Russian mathematicians started to get international recognition for their payments (russian math). Figures such as Nikolai Lobachevsky, who created non-Euclidean geometry, and Sofia Kovalevskaya, the very first woman to hold a professorship in mathematics, contributed in raising the condition of Russian maths on the global phase. The facility of the St. Petersburg Academy of Sciences in 1724 more bolstered mathematical research, bring in eminent scholars and promoting a collective environment


The Soviet era saw a substantial development of mathematical research and education and learning. Institutions like Moscow State College and the Steklov Institute of Mathematics became hubs for mathematical innovation. The rigorous pedagogical approaches and emphasis on analytic that arised during this period remain to influence the way Russian mathematics is taught today.


Developing Critical Thinking



Cultivating essential reasoning is a foundational objective of Russian mathematics education, which highlights deep conceptual understanding over memorizing memorization. This instructional approach urges students to involve with mathematical principles on an extensive level, fostering an environment where query and logical thinking are vital. By delving right into the "why" and "just how" behind mathematical concepts, students establish the capability to synthesize and evaluate info, instead than simply remembering realities.


Russian math education employs a variety of methods to reinforce essential reasoning. Amongst these, the Socratic method sticks out, as it entails educators posing provocative concerns that call for trainees to verbalize and defend their reasoning. This technique not only sharpens analytical abilities however also boosts spoken communication capabilities. Additionally, the educational program usually consists of facility, multi-step troubles that necessitate a clear understanding of underlying concepts and the ability to apply them in brand-new contexts.




In addition, Russian mathematics places a solid focus on evidence and sensible reductions, needing students to build and critique arguments systematically. This extensive intellectual exercise grows a self-displined method to problem-solving and refines the pupils' capacity to think individually and seriously, preparing them for diverse academic and professional challenges.
